Prudential Carolinas Realty Salary

As of May 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Prudential Carolinas Realty in the United States is $108,402.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$52. Salaries at Prudential Carolinas Realty typically range from $95,127 to $122,927 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Chapel Hill?

Understanding the cost of living near Chapel Hill is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Prudential Carolinas Realty.
Chapel Hill's Cost of Living Index is approximately 117.3 (17.3% more expensive than US average; 22.2% more than NC average). Home to UNC-Chapel Hill, very desirable, high housing costs.
